Welcome!

Join our community of MMO enthusiasts and game developers! By registering, you'll gain access to discussions on the latest developments in MMO server files and collaborate with like-minded individuals. Join us today and unlock the potential of MMO server development!

Join Today!

Steam Master server emulator - TINserver

----
Loyal Member
Joined
Mar 26, 2008
Messages
1,038
Reaction score
413
STEAM - TIN MASTER SERVER EMULATOR

Here is a STEAM master server emulator with custom client. Perhaps lots of you guys know this emulator, but there are people who is not. So please dont be a troll about it, it is a good tool usable for VPNs and LAN.

Now people you must to know some things before we begin:
0. All credit goes to steamCooker for the server, and for machine 4578 for cream api. I just repacked the whole thing, but you will need to setup yours.

1. There is NO SOURCE. (never will be most propably. But it can be used for private uses) if you are not intrested if no source then close this thread and go away, useless to make complaints about it.

2. NO, YOU WONT ABLE to download games from original steam with this it is not what is ment for! This is an independent system. it is not what this program is ment for. YOU need to get your games. You can add subscriptions but they will most likely not work. You will neeed a wrapper for it(its in the tools folder called cream api) all this api does that you can play multiplayer thru vpn/public if everyone has the SAME version game as yours.

After you setup your client(Download and edited your IP in INI files) you can send the client folder to other people to join to your server.


3. There are features missing(EG: voice chat, sharing, detailed achievements ect.)

4. This program works like the original steam(Uses chat, invitations, achivements, matchmaking, steam overlay, groupchat, picture sending, clan and team management, and ingame web browser as the original, it also stores remote saves for games.)

5. This is not a simple system to use, it uses sqlite3, and for the first start you will need to make a free steam account, for the first update and for the database. After that YOU WONT NEED ANY STEAM ACCOUNT FOR FURTHER USAGE JUST THIS ONCE AT THE FIRST INSTALL! only if you want to update your server/db/client, but it is not mandatory after this. it just grabs the client and some files that this thing is needed. It uses original client but with an own hooks to redirect it to your own servers, so basicly your client will not even work if the tin server is not running, and also the client gets the update from your emulator server :D not from valve.

After you start the server itself it will obtain all licence keys and manifests from the servers, when it is finished the emulator will be about at 1GB size. It will grab all appid and data from games from steam that it is required and mandatory for it.

6. You can add somehow your own content to be downloadable thru your steam server, but it is a hard thing to do. I was not able to do.

7. Absolutely no support for it beside the howto install.txt in the archives.

8. All tutorials experiences are welcome here, but keep in mind every game is different.

9. DONT ASK HELP ABOUT MAKING A 'X' or 'Y' GAME WORK WITH THIS! THIS IS NOT A WAREZ FORUM! IF YOU ASK FOR CRACKED CONTENT I WILL IMMIDIATELY REPORT YOU AND ASK FOR A BAN FROM THE MODS!

10. The wrapper itself has a good detailed file how to setup the games refer with that or with google! Just dont do it here.

11. STRONGLY Discourage anyone to use this as a public service! Its for private gaming.

12. IF someone will report the link i will upload and upload and upload to more and more places. OR i will make a torrent from it so i dont advice it, Dont push me people!

13. There is a TOOLS folder, check up for further programs there too.

14. Also you need to add your games as NON steam games. The network will kick in after you start the game itself. Dont worry. It works, but you cannot use them as original games, all api will run under APPID 480, or edit cream api to use some other free game ID... check on steam appid db...

15. DONT USE IT AS PARALELL OF THE ORIGINAL STEAM AND DONT USE YOUR REGULAR PASSWORDS/USERNAMES! CLOSE EVERY STEAM APP BEFORE YOU USING THIS(Close all client bootstrapper too in your machine, in the background)

16. THIS WHOLE THING WILL NOT WORK WITH GAMES LIKE MMORPGS, OR WITH EA GAMES UPLAY SERVICES, OR GAMES THAT USES HIS OWN NETWORKING, ITS ONLY WORKS WITH STEAM BASED MATCHMAKING GAMES!

EDIT YOUR PICSdownloader.ini FILE BEFORE USAGE;

And as always: There are not all games are compatible wit this, so some will work, some are not. Life is though. Get over it. Also, i am not taking any responsibility for the harm may comes to you if you use this. Use at your own risk!(Also i dont accept PMs anymore so dont even bother.)

So the emulator pack itself:




Also there is the missing tools folder with cream api (I accidentally missed it out from the archives):



Update: Tools for archive files.(ACF,MANIFEST, KEYLOADER ECT)

It contains a few updates too. so Here is what is what:

TINserver.2019-01-11.7z - > Emulator itself the client is in the client folder, but first you need to make the program download it! (Check installation TXT-files)

TINserver.fix.20190121.7z - >Update for the main exe

TINserver.fix.20190128.7z - >Latest update to the main exe(just overwrite the old one)

TINserver.linux.2019-01-11.7z - >Linux binaries, DONT ASK ABOUT IT I CANNOT HELP WITH IT!

TINserver.txt - > How to setup the whole thing.

TINserver.fix.missing emoticons.zip - >Missing chat icons, copy into the appropriate directories.

TINserverClient.winxp.2018-06-07.zip - >Windows XP supported client.
As for how to setup there is a TXT file in the archives, so read and use your common sense about it!

NOTE: You will need 80 and 443 ports for use this, as it supports other ports but somehow it does not works with the redirected ports. so you need 80, and 443... Also the games might need some other port forwarding if you are on a NAT router.
BY DEFAULT THE FRIEND SYSTEM IS AUTO ADDING EVERY NEW MEMBERS TO EVERYONE'S FRIENDLIST, THIS CAN BE TURNED OFF IF YOU WANT!


Screenshot(you can change the language to some other and/or you can change the region, money, look and work as like the original clients.):




Regards. Have fun.
 
Last edited:
Junior Spellweaver
Joined
Oct 3, 2017
Messages
125
Reaction score
49
I don't know what I'm doing wrong but it never lets me log in and always says that I have certificate issues I went into the folder under data called certificate and created all the certificates but it's still no certificate
 
----
Loyal Member
Joined
Mar 26, 2008
Messages
1,038
Reaction score
413
You dont need any cert file if you are using on lan(EG: i am using on my vpn with 192.168.x.x ), on public domain; I dont know, follow the install guide. It worked for me... :\

Also: you did made a free account before first usage? it need to download a LOTS of things from steam before you can register and sign in...
 
Skilled Illusionist
Joined
May 25, 2014
Messages
354
Reaction score
29
lets say i have a private server
can i use this as a patcher?
also a downloader?
the same as how steam works?
 
----
Loyal Member
Joined
Mar 26, 2008
Messages
1,038
Reaction score
413
lets say i have a private server
can i use this as a patcher?
also a downloader?
the same as how steam works?

Yes, and yes and yes, however you have to edit the manifests and keys to the archives,(Dont ask how) if you change the game, you need to change the hash too. Otherwise it will not work(it will say that it cannot connect to the update service but in reality this isnt the problem, it has hash problems).
 
Last edited:
----
Loyal Member
Joined
Mar 26, 2008
Messages
1,038
Reaction score
413
The information is mostly on the TXT files in the archives in the appropriate directories... Read before post, also you provided nothing as information. As i said:You Cannot download original games with this, also you need original steam content files(EG game cache manifests) for this if you want to make an original like server(To be able to download, you must use your own games at appropriate folders and eveyrone will be able to DL the game from your server, and yes you can use as an update server. But only with contend correctly edited and placed, also it is not recommended to use 127.0.0.1), but it is hard, you need to make a wrapper and somehow able to edit the server manifest files. Other solution is: Make a wrapper that runs the games with ID480 (Cream_api capable for that)...

Also this thing main purpose is to make the private gaming more user friendly, to work on VPN lan or publicly, but private without any connection to anywhere... AND you can distribute your own patches if you are able to make correct cache files, i would also need any tool for it....
 
Last edited:
Newbie Spellweaver
Joined
Jun 19, 2016
Messages
65
Reaction score
13
thx, It would be nice if the source code was. I hope when it will be available
 
Last edited:
----
Loyal Member
Joined
Mar 26, 2008
Messages
1,038
Reaction score
413
thx, It would be nice if the source code was. I hope when it will be available
Sadly steamCooker currently not wishes to give up the source, and he said if he would in one day only for closed source projects... so who knows...


UPDATE (Added to main post also):



These tools is for making downloadable content somehow. Made by the same guy who made this emulator.

"Tools 2\CEGDownloader.2014-12-11.7z" - CEG emulator(For executables)
"Tools 2\steamGuardKeygen.7z" - This is just a downloader,:D you need a free account for this you can setup in this ini file in the zip
"Tools 2\TINcft.2019-01-30.7z" - Archive editor
 
Last edited:
Newbie Spellweaver
Joined
Jun 19, 2016
Messages
65
Reaction score
13
It would also be nice if could change these html branches.
O76fnYT - Steam Master server emulator - TINserver - RaGEZONE Forums
 

Attachments

You must be registered for see attachments list
Newbie Spellweaver
Joined
Jan 6, 2018
Messages
43
Reaction score
4
If anyone know at least one really good soft that can easily hack .exe files and have included dialog builder inside it will be awesome
 
CATMAGEDDON
Loyal Member
Joined
Aug 17, 2014
Messages
1,666
Reaction score
293
so its like PAC Steam?and no easy way to pack my own "super legal adquired not from torrents or anything aheemskidrowreloaded sites" games then share them on lan?
 
----
Loyal Member
Joined
Mar 26, 2008
Messages
1,038
Reaction score
413
Something like that its for playing lan/online with your own "public service games what you are sharing on the lan".. XD But the sharing part is still a thing that i try to figure out how to be done... But it can be done... also some features are missing.
 
Last edited:
----
Loyal Member
Joined
Mar 26, 2008
Messages
1,038
Reaction score
413
yea, you have to setup your region in emulator, by default it is set to US, but you can change it in tinserver.ini however eveyrone will have the same region when others joins too. But you need to obtain your own game.
 
----
Loyal Member
Joined
Mar 26, 2008
Messages
1,038
Reaction score
413
Just as much as the original steam... you can add your own, but it wont utilise the steam network, on some cases the layer works... but the point is the emulation of the steam... -.-' so it is for mainly steam programs...
 
Back
Top